We are currently recruiting for an In Port Engineer to join our existing team on a 12-month fixed term contract. This role supports the Maritime Services Contract in Devonport and is responsible for supporting the Vessel Master with all matters pertaining to engineering and electrical operation, maintenance, and defect rectification.

 

Main responsibilities of the role include:

  • Responsible for the operations of the engine room and maintenance of all types of machinery and equipment onboard the vessel.
  • Responsible for ensuring that all vessel machinery and equipment is working in an efficient manner to support safe navigation.
  • Ensure that adequate safety precautions are taken prior to any task.
  • Keep all engine room records as required by the Company.
  • Endeavour to maximise efficiency of machinery and equipment.
  • Ensure that any repair work being undertaken by sub-contractors is being carried out in a safe and satisfactory manner.
  • Ensure all measures to prevent pollution of the environment are always exercised.
  • Fully conversant with Company Safety Management System.
  • Carry out other duties as may be reasonably requested by the Master.
  • Liaise and consult with the Operations cell and Management Team as necessary.
  • Communicate effectively with Customers, Management and Office Staff.

 

What you'll need to do the role:

  • ENG 1 Medical
  • STCW Certificate of Competency - Chief Engineer (minimum of 3000Kw)
  • STCW Personal Survival Techniques (PST)
  • STCW Personal Safety and Social Responsibilities (PSSR)
  • STCW Fire Prevention and Fire Fighting (FP&FF)
  • STCW Advanced Fire Fighting (AFF)
  • STCW Certificate of Proficiency in Survival Craft & Rescue Boats (PSCRB)
  • STCW Elementary First Aid
  • STCW Medical First Aid
  • Marine Industry background
  • UK Passport Holder / Eligibility to work in the UK due to Naval Base security requirements
